Old Dominion University (ODU) in Norfolk, Virginia, is a top-tier R1 public research institution renowned for its coastal resilience initiatives and highly regarded programs in engineering, nursing, cybersecurity, and maritime supply chain management. On campus, students experience a vibrant, highly diverse community fueled by division-one athletics, active student organizations, and easy access to Norfolk’s thriving arts district and nearby beaches. What truly sets ODU apart is its strategic partnership with major national entities like NASA and the world’s largest naval base, which translates into unparalleled, hands-on internship and career opportunities for undergraduate students.
Wikipedia:Old Dominion University (ODU) is a public research university in Norfolk, Virginia, United States. Established in 1930 as the two-year Norfolk Division of the College of William & Mary, the school became an independent college in 1962 and attained university status in 1969. In 2023, it had an enrollment of 23,494 students, and its main campus covers 250 acres.
